Mt. Pleasant: Arduino Programming @ The Center of Excellence in STEM Education

July 15 @9:00 am-12:00 pm

|Recurring Event (See all)

One event on July 16, 2024 at 9:00 am

One event on July 17, 2024 at 9:00 am

One event on July 18, 2024 at 9:00 am

$25

6th – 12th Grade
Meets on campus from 9am to 12pm, July 15-18
Led by Brian DeJong, a CMU engineering faculty member

Learn basic text programming using Arduino Unos and electronics kits. You will program the Arduinos to listen to sensors and to control motors as you build ultrasonic alerts, guess-the-number LCDs, “Simon Says” button games, and “useless boxes”. No prior programming experience is needed; code will be adjustable to all skill levels.
